ubusd: fix sending remove-object notification

Patch by Delio Brignoli <brignoli.delio@gmail.com>

Both ubusd_free_object (eventually via ubusd_create_object_event_msg)
and ubus_proto_send_msg_from_blob() use the same message buffer.
So ubusd_handle_remove_object builds the payload which gets (indirectly)
overwritten by the call to ubusd_free_object and then sent again by
ubus_proto_send_msg_from_blob.
